The Evolution of Connectivity: From Massive Cables to Micro-Tech 🚀 In the 1940s, early computers like the ENIAC were massive, room-sized machines that relied on thick, bulky data cables to transmit even the simplest signals. These heavy wires were essential for connecting various components, but they made systems incredibly large and inefficient. Managing these "nests" of cables required constant manual adjustment, illustrating the sheer physical scale of first-generation computing. 🔌 As computer engineering evolved, these giant cables shrank into the microscopic, high-speed connections we use today. This rapid transition from room-sized hardware to pocket-sized powerhouses highlights a massive leap in efficiency and material science. Early computers like ENIAC were massive machines that filled entire rooms and required teams of people to operate. Instead of screens or keyboards, programs were set up by manually plugging cables and adjusting switches. The system used thousands of vacuum tubes to process calculations, generating large amounts of heat and requiring constant maintenance. Data was input using punch cards, and results were displayed through printed outputs or indicator lights. Despite their size and complexity, these machines laid the foundation for modern computing.

Prototype “clock-like” device dating from around 1970, based in the date codes of the ICs. This does not actually function as a clock, but it does count up at various speeds. Perhaps it was to demonstrate that LEDs could be used to tell the time. Whatever it is, a lot of hard work and engineering went into making it, all hand wired and soldered, driven entirely using logic gates and transistors. #vintage #electronicsengineering #texasinstruments #led #computerhistory
